PushIt! v0.1.0 - Image 1Ti-Ra-Nog presents to us his DS brew game, PushIt v0.1.0. It's actually a little old, a little new type of game as it is a modified DDR-ish type of game.

Here's what we could get so far from the translation. This game is sort of like DJMax or, as mentioned earlier, DDR. However, the difference is that "with the touch of nds (touch screen) and instead to raise or lower the "keys" to press, these are going toward the center." Pardon the translation, that's the best we can do.

Anyway, the screenshots do provide an idea how it goes, and the download link's below. Here's hoping you enjoy.

Translation, by me. :D

Installation: The game needs the DLDI patch to work correctly. In the archive attached, there are 3 versions of the game: One for R4, another for super card SD, and the last one without a patch. How to play: The gameplay is kinda hard to explain: - First, go to the options menu.(press select in the main screen) and choose between right-handed, or left-handed mode. - Then return to the mani screen, with the A button you can save the changes. - Press start to start the game. The game consists in using the styles to move the pentagon in the screen(you have to hold down the stylus) and touch the balls that appear. Once the pentagon is on the ball, you have to press the correct button in the console. If the ball reaches the middle before making it disappear(touching it), ^ And it ends there. It's incomplete. But I guess you lose a point if you don't touch a ball.
